Bahrain - Re-Export of Live Pure-Bred Breeding Horses

Since 2014, Bahrain Re-Export of Live Pure-Bred Breeding Horses rose 22.2% year on year. At $25,292.51 in 2019, the country was ranked number 7 among other countries in Re-Export of Live Pure-Bred Breeding Horses. Bahrain is overtaken by Oman, which was number 6 at $153,305.58 and is followed by Jordan at $23,382.84. United States topped the ranking with $84,965,613.26 in 2019, that is -8.2% compared to 2018. New Zealand, Canada and United Arab Emirates resp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. United States witnessed the best average annual growth at +93.1% per year, while United Arab Emirates was the worst growing country at -31.5% per year.
